Our client is a leading UK technology and infrastructure specialist, delivering mission-critical communications and digital systems across rail, transport, utilities and public services.

Responsibilities:

  • Commercial leadership of the Network Infrastructure Portfolio
  • Cost control, forecasting, AFC management, monthly cost reporting and cashflow forecasting
  • Managing change control, Early Warnings and variations via CEMAR, including pricing and agreeing client changes
  • Supporting efficiency targets across CP7
  • Developing contracting and packaging strategies
  • Managing subcontract procurement, valuations, payments and final accounts
  • Supporting portfolio risk and opportunity management
  • Expanding into other areas of the Safety & Security Portfolio, leading on SISS, Southern Infrastructure Delivery and Ops Comms projects
  • Preparing, overseeing and ensuring monthly client applications for payment are issued in accordance with the contract and certified in a timely manner
  • Administration of contracts in collaboration with the commercial team
  • Reporting monthly on cost/value reconciliation and supporting monthly contract reviews with senior management
  • Negotiating and agreeing final accounts with the client
  • Supporting the Project Manager in the preparation of delay claims and associated quantum
  • Establishing and maintaining administration procedures for the supporting Quantity Surveying team

Qualifications/experience:

  • Demonstrable Quantity Surveying experience (10 years' +) working either for a client, contractor or subcontractor covering a portfolio of complex projects
  • Experience within the construction industry is preferred
  • Strong post-contract Quantity surveying experience
  • Commercial awareness
  • Ability to work under pressure and use initiative
  • Working knowledge of forms of designated business sector contract (NEC)
  • Experience of web-based contract administration tools – CEMAR
